titleOfInvention | COMPOSITIONS FOR CARE OF THE ORAL CAVITY AND THEIR APPLICATION |
abstract | 1. Two-phase composition for rinsing the oral cavity, including:! hydrophobic phase; ! hydrophilic phase; and! hydrotropic component,! in which the hydrophobic and hydrophilic phases spontaneously separate after mixing the phases and the composition does not contain an emulsion for one hour after mixing. ! 2. The composition according to claim 1, in which the hydrotropic component comprises polyglycol, polyhydric alcohol, or a mixture thereof. ! 3. The composition according to claim 1 or 2, in which the hydrotropic component includes 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, glycerin, diethyl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, tripropylene glycol, hexylene glycol, 1,3-butylene glycol, 1,4-butylene glycol, 1,2,6-hexanetriol, sorbitol xylitol or a combination thereof. ! 4. The composition according to claim 1, in which the hydrotropic component comprises glycerin and propylene glycol. ! 5. The composition according to claim 1, in which the hydrotropic component comprises sorbitol. ! 6. The composition according to claim 1, in which the hydrophobic phase comprises an oil selected from isopropyl myristate, mineral oil, edible oil, and combinations thereof. ! 7. The composition according to claim 1, comprising the active ingredient. ! 8.
